Warner Bros. has set its eyes on an I Am Legend franchise, bringing in two of Hollywood's top players to star in the film. Not only is Will Smith making a return to the sequel, but Black Panther actor Michael B. Jordan is signed to star as well. This is the duo's first big movie together as both producers and stars.

Deadline reports that Oscar winne Akiva Goldsman, who originally adapted the 1954 Richard Matheson novel for the 2007 film, will also return to pen the script to the follow-up. I Am Legend was initially directed by Francis Lawrence, where Smith played a virologist by the name of Rober Neville. He was stranded in New York City as the sole survivor of a man-made plague that transformed humans into bloodthirsty mutants. The film opened at the top of the box office raking in $77 million USD, later earning over $585 million USD globally.

The news comes amidst Smith's Oscar recognition for King Richard and the launch of the new Bel-Air TV series. Jordan is also in the middle of production for his directorial debut for Creed III. There is no word on when the sequel to I Am Legend will release.
